On 09/02/2015 03:23 PM, Sagi Grimberg wrote:
> Since patch series "Demux IB CM requests in the rdma_cm module" the
> P_Key index is taken from the work completion rather than the message
> itself.
>
> The HCA provides us with the message P_Key. In order to provide the
> P_Key index, we need to look it up. Given that this is relevant only
> for GSI messages (session establishments) which is less performance critical,
> micro-optimize against the GSI (is_qp1) branch.

> di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/cq.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/cq.c
> index 640c54e..3dfd287 100644
> ---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/cq.c
> +++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/cq.c
> @@ -33,6 +33,7 @@
> #include <linux/kref.h>
> #include <rdma/ib_umem.h>
> #include <rdma/ib_user_verbs.h>
> +#include <rdma/ib_cache.h>
> #include "mlx5_ib.h"
> #include "user.h"
>
> @@ -227,7 +228,14 @@ static void handle_responder(struct ib_wc *wc, struct mlx5_cqe64 *cqe,
> wc->dlid_path_bits = cqe->ml_path;
> g = (be32_to_cpu(cqe->flags_rqpn) >> 28) & 3;
> wc->wc_flags |= g ? IB_WC_GRH : 0;
> - wc->pkey_index = be32_to_cpu(cqe->imm_inval_pkey) & 0xffff;
> + if (unlikely(is_qp1(qp->ibqp.qp_type))) {
> + u16 pkey = be32_to_cpu(cqe->imm_inval_pkey) & 0xffff;
> +
> + ib_find_cached_pkey(&dev->ib_dev, qp->port, pkey,
> + &wc->pkey_index);
> + } else {
> + wc->pkey_index = 0;
> + }
> }
>
> static void dump_cqe(struct mlx5_ib_dev *dev, struct mlx5_err_cqe *cqe)
> di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h
> index fc987fe..a4ef6a7 100644
> ---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h
> +++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h
> @@ -656,6 +656,11 @@ static inline u8 convert_access(int acc)
> MLX5_PERM_LOCAL_READ;
> }
>
> +static inline int is_qp1(enum ib_qp_type qp_type)
> +{
> + return qp_type == IB_QPT_GSI;
> +}
> +
> #define MLX5_MAX_UMR_SHIFT 16
> #define MLX5_MAX_UMR_PAGES (1 << MLX5_MAX_UMR_SHIFT)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/qp.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/qp.c
> index 9380d2d..8c51ea3 100644
> ---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/qp.c
> +++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/qp.c
> @@ -76,11 +76,6 @@ static int is_qp0(enum ib_qp_type qp_type)
> return qp_type == IB_QPT_SMI;
> }
>
> -static int is_qp1(enum ib_qp_type qp_type)
> -{
> - return qp_type == IB_QPT_GSI;
> -}
> -
> static int is_sqp(enum ib_qp_type qp_type)
> {
> return is_qp0(qp_type) || is_qp1(qp_type);
>
